Update to version 2.4.22 (commit 618c607a249dd7fd2ffc662c6531143833bebd44)

This commit is contained in:
g.schulz 2026-01-27 18:13:22 +00:00
parent ca5ae15ebc
commit 556f81e405
2 changed files with 9 additions and 9 deletions

View file

@ -1,23 +1,23 @@
pkgbase = cursor-bin
pkgdesc = AI-first coding environment
pkgver = 2.4.21
pkgver = 2.4.22
pkgrel = 1
url = https://www.cursor.com
arch = x86_64
license = LicenseRef-Cursor_EULA
depends = xdg-utils
depends = ripgrep
depends = electron37
depends = electron
depends = nodejs
depends = gcc-libs
depends = hicolor-icon-theme
depends = libxkbfile
noextract = cursor_2.4.21_amd64.deb
noextract = cursor_2.4.22_amd64.deb
options = !strip
source = https://downloads.cursor.com/production/dc8361355d709f306d5159635a677a571b277bcc/linux/x64/deb/amd64/deb/cursor_2.4.21_amd64.deb
source = https://downloads.cursor.com/production/618c607a249dd7fd2ffc662c6531143833bebd44/linux/x64/deb/amd64/deb/cursor_2.4.22_amd64.deb
source = https://gitlab.archlinux.org/archlinux/packaging/packages/code/-/raw/main/code.sh
source = rg.sh
sha512sums = 5fdd1bf30209b10354e35086be711385f44fae6336b5a8546b2ed83d3b538ba886fc9064cbd05af4e43c205c1abe606b3159bfeffa5869a7422d69794ae98e6f
sha512sums = af60efa7ea29c3ce6178705ccf730ee4ad0f5984bf25bf4124b5db079fdee9ae0588f99f04e2a467d57804a262f8b1734e87686a5c0d69cffaa281002aa3fe8b
sha512sums = 937299c6cb6be2f8d25f7dbc95cf77423875c5f8353b8bd6cd7cc8e5603cbf8405b14dbf8bd615db2e3b36ed680fc8e1909410815f7f8587b7267a699e00ab37
sha512sums = e79fe7659f59d1ae02fc68816399bfd31587315df6cdb6ccf1d0ca76f7cdc692c2a42b30591c0091147bd97ef14b1c7745dc26bd7cb3ea6bba45698e5044fa2a

View file

@ -1,23 +1,23 @@
# Maintainer: Gunther Schulz <dev@guntherschulz.de>
pkgname=cursor-bin
pkgver=2.4.21
pkgver=2.4.22
pkgrel=1
pkgdesc='AI-first coding environment'
arch=('x86_64')
url="https://www.cursor.com"
license=('LicenseRef-Cursor_EULA')
_electron=electron37
_electron=electron
depends=(xdg-utils ripgrep $_electron nodejs
'gcc-libs' 'hicolor-icon-theme' 'libxkbfile')
options=(!strip) # Don't break ext of VSCode
_commit=dc8361355d709f306d5159635a677a571b277bcc
_commit=618c607a249dd7fd2ffc662c6531143833bebd44
source=("https://downloads.cursor.com/production/${_commit}/linux/x64/deb/amd64/deb/cursor_${pkgver}_amd64.deb"
https://gitlab.archlinux.org/archlinux/packaging/packages/code/-/raw/main/code.sh rg.sh)
sha512sums=('SKIP'
'937299c6cb6be2f8d25f7dbc95cf77423875c5f8353b8bd6cd7cc8e5603cbf8405b14dbf8bd615db2e3b36ed680fc8e1909410815f7f8587b7267a699e00ab37'
'e79fe7659f59d1ae02fc68816399bfd31587315df6cdb6ccf1d0ca76f7cdc692c2a42b30591c0091147bd97ef14b1c7745dc26bd7cb3ea6bba45698e5044fa2a')
sha512sums[0]=5fdd1bf30209b10354e35086be711385f44fae6336b5a8546b2ed83d3b538ba886fc9064cbd05af4e43c205c1abe606b3159bfeffa5869a7422d69794ae98e6f
sha512sums[0]=af60efa7ea29c3ce6178705ccf730ee4ad0f5984bf25bf4124b5db079fdee9ae0588f99f04e2a467d57804a262f8b1734e87686a5c0d69cffaa281002aa3fe8b
noextract=(cursor_${pkgver}_amd64.deb) # avoid double tarball
_app=usr/share/cursor/resources/app
package() {